What's the best time of year to travel to Silay City with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ually May and April with an average temp of 82°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 79°F. The rainiest months in Silay City are July, September, June, and October, with each month seeing an average of 15 inches of rainfall.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Silay City?
Known for its ruins and architecture, Silay City has lots to offer visitors including its churches, university life, and monuments. See the local sights and visit MagikLand and Manuel de la Rama Locsin House. While you're there, make sure you don't miss Bernardino Jalandoni Museum and Maria Ledesma Gomez Heritage Building.
